The Works in the Vicinity of the Arch of Saint Vincent Bring to Light a Romanesque Necropolis

The heritage and historical wealth of Ávila is undeniable, and proof of this is that every time a point of the city is opened for works can emerge any new archaeological finding. That is precisely what has happened with the latest works in the vicinity of the San Vicente arch, which have revealed to us a Romanesque necropolis.Rosa Ruiz, a municipal archeologist, has told COPE about the main discoveries that this excavation is leaving.
